Anatel A643a Setup
5.1
General Information
Once they have been installed, Anatel A643a Analyzers can begin analysis immediately based
on the factory default parameters. The user can selectively alter these default values to tailor
the instrument’s operation to the requirements of the particular application.
Anatel A643a Analyzers run in one of three data-gathering modes:

Auto TOC
is the Analyzer’s standard operational mode for monitoring any high-
purity water system. In this mode, the instrument automatically
performs successive TOC analyses and reports the results until the
cycle is interrupted by the user.
Purge Mode
opens the Analyzer’s internal sample valve, allowing sample water to
flow through the instrument and flush the measurement cell.
Conductivity (or resistivity) and temperature readings are reported.
Manual Mode
allows the user to interrupt automatic operation and manually initiate
an analysis cycle. A single on-line sample from the water system or a
grab sample of off-line water sources, such as a sample vial can be
analyzed.
